The 3M 7010312432 is a blue polyester tape with a silicone adhesive backing, engineered for demanding high-temperature masking applications. The tape measures 3 inches wide by 72 yards long with a 2.4 mil total thickness. The polyester film carrier provides dimensional stability under heat, while the silicone adhesive bonds reliably to a range of surfaces without leaving residue. This tape is used primarily in industrial and finishing environments by trade professionals handling powder coating operations, composite fabrication, and liner-handling workflows.
This tape is suited for powder coating and flash breaker or bag sealing applications where conventional acrylic-adhesive tapes would fail under elevated temperatures. It is also used for splicing, tabbing, and roll closing on silicone-treated liners or release materials. The blue color aids visual identification during masking and removal. Both industrial finishers and composite fabricators keep this tape on hand for repetitive high-temperature process work.
Designed for use on silicone-treated liners, release materials, and surfaces encountered in high-temperature masking, powder coating, and composite bag sealing applications.
Application should be performed by trained finishing or fabrication technicians familiar with surface preparation requirements for the specific substrate. Ensure surfaces are clean and free of dust, oils, and moisture before applying the tape. Remove the tape promptly after the process cycle is complete to reduce the risk of adhesive interaction with the substrate at extended dwell times. Follow facility safety protocols when working in heated or pressurized environments.
